  • 2 Amp Battery Charger vs. 1 Amp: Understanding the Difference
    No, a 2 amp battery charger is not the same as a 1 amp charger. Here's why:

    * Amperage (Amps) determines charging speed. A 2 amp charger can deliver twice as much current (electricity) to the battery as a 1 amp charger. This means it will charge the battery faster.

    * Matching the charger to the battery is important. You should use a charger that is compatible with the battery's specifications. Using a charger with too high of an amperage can damage the battery, while one with too low of an amperage will charge very slowly.

    Think of it like this:

    * 1 amp charger: It's like a small hose watering a plant slowly.

    * 2 amp charger: It's like a larger hose watering the plant quickly.

    In short, a 2 amp charger is more powerful than a 1 amp charger and can charge a battery faster.
